<strong>The Yeti Sammich</strong> is not your ordinary cold cut sub with choice cuts of gourmet prosciutto and capocollo layered with provolone and mozzarella. Add to this lettuce, tomato, onion, sweet peppers, and a liberal helping of Italian spices all inside a hoagie roll and you have yourself an outstanding Royal Gorge original. Flavor this full-bodied and satisfying is almost as elusive as the Yeti itself! As with all our <a href="http://www.gorgeyourself.com/menu.html">sandwiches</a>, kettle chips or fries and a pickle garnish the sandwich in proper tavern fashion.<br />
The Yeti’s North American cousin, Sasquatch, has a sandwich too: <strong>The Sasquatch</strong> consists of over half a pound of grilled rib-eye with horse radish and onions on a hoagie roll.<br />
<img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-23" title="royal_gorge_yeti_bites" src="http://www.gorgeyourself.com/blog/wp-content/uploads/2011/11/royal_gorge_yeti_bites.jpg" alt="Yeti Bites at Royal Gorge" width="440" height="300" /><br />
<strong>Yeti Bites</strong> are our famed sweet treat delicacy. Made out of pizza dough, they are mini sopapilla-looking pastry pillows drizzled with cinnamon and sugar and served with a side of honey. They’re great finger food for sharing around the office, but since they’re so addictive you might want to get two orders!<br />
<img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-24" title="royal_gorge_yeti_beer" src="http://www.gorgeyourself.com/blog/wp-content/uploads/2011/11/royal_gorge_yeti_beer.jpg" alt="Great Divide Yeti Beer with Yeti" width="440" height="300" /><br />
Not to be forgotten are our <strong>Yeti beers</strong> from local Denver brewery Great Divide Brewery Company. Choose from several blends (imperial stout, oak aged, chocolate aged, or espresso aged) of the finest Yeti-inspired malt liquors. The bold flavors include deep caramel and toffee notes and more hops per unit than the average beer. 						<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Posted in <a href="http://www.gorgeyourself.com/blog/category/menu/" title="View all posts in Menu" rel="category tag">Menu</a></p><p>Here at the Royal Gorge, we’re aware of the limited gluten-free options out there. That’s why we’ve made a conscious effort to accommodate those customers with some recipes and products without gluten. So if you’re looking for a gluten-free pizza on your lunch break, the Royal Gorge offers up a savory option in the Denver Tech Center: our 10” gluten-free crust with either regular or non-dairy cheese added as well as any of our regular toppings to choose from at a reasonable $11.99. Rest assured, all meat used at Royal Gorge is certified gluten-free as well. Flavor is not compromised as the gluten-free crust is every bit as delicious as our others, so whether you’re gluten-intolerant or not you’ll be sure to love this one.</p>
